Am now facing a weird problem! When I try to build a "Make VS.NET" step which was generated dynamically, I get this error:

Object reference not set to an instance of an object.

When I go to the step properities, check & uncheck some property (So that the Apply button is enabled) and then click on OK. Now I try to execute this step and I dont get the above listed error!!!!!! Hope I conveyed the issue.
